Sunday the 26th, A Good Yarn


As the Pheasantry in Bushey is closed for refurb, a change of 11's venue was called. So the golden Grill in Ashford was deemed a suitable replacement, it is also nearer the lunch stop, The Good Yarn in Uxbridge.

There was a good turnout of Ed, Simon, Pam, Dave W, Dave E, Graham, Diane, Lillian, Bernard, Sabina and Geoff, and all were joining the ride, The route to lunch was roughly 21/22 miles, which in the end I did shorten to around 19.

It was a route we had used parts of in years gone by, and I added some sneaky extra miles. The distance did take its toll on Ed, who bonked a few miles short of Uxbridge. However, he did make it to lunch with the assistance of Dave, Simon and Geoff.

The lunch venue was packed, but luckily most were just there for the booze, so food service was prompt.

Ed and Lillian headed for the station to catch a train home, while the rest of us headed South, I took a shortish route through Heathrow to Bedfont where Pam left us for her route home, on and through Hampton where I left the group and Simon guided the remaining few to Hampton court to make their own ways home. A really good day on the bike but somewhat still too chilly.

Thank you all for your company and especially to Simon for back marking
